The Westerly Berwick is a traditionally styled family cruiser designed by Laurent Giles.  They have good accommodation and moderate draft, making them ideal for the shallow waters of the East Coast and beyond. This example has been under the same ownership for the past 29 years, the engine was replaced in 2004.

Accommodation

The accommodation offers up to six berths in two cabins. In the forecabin, V berth with infill and stowage under. Opening hatch to foredeck. Hanging locker. Separate heads to port with marine toilet and basin with a manually pumped cold water supply. Hanging locker opposite. In saloon, dinette to starboard with galley and settee berth opposite. Two burner gimballed gas cooker with grill and oven. Sink with a manually pumped cold water supply. Fixed saloon table (large saloon table available). Two quarter berths port and starboard. Brown leather upholstery throughout.

Mechanical Systems

Located behind the companionway is the Volvo Penta 2030 fitted new in 2004. Freshwater cooled via a heat exchanger. single lever controls. 4 cylinders, 29hp. Shaft driven to a fixed 3 bladed propeller. Rope cutter. Approximately 61 litre plastic tank. Serviced every winter by the owner. Approximately 2000 hours on the engine.

Spars and Sails

Masthead rigged Bermudan sloop. Deck stepped alloy mast and boom. Stainless steel standing rigging (2009). Terylene running rigging. Slab reefing to mainsail. Headsail furling system. Two Barlow halyard winches. Two Barlow sheet winches. Genoa cover.

Construction

Westerly Berwick. built in 1975 by Westerly Marine Construction to a design by Laurent Giles. White GRP hull. White GRP superstructure with painted non-slip to deck. Teak rubbing strakes. Twin keels. Tiller steering to skeg hung rudder. Aft self draining cockpit.
